Network settings

  1. Press the OK key when the phone is idle to get the IP address of the phone
  2. Open the web browser of your computer, enter the IP address into the addres bar (e.g. "http://192.168.0.10" or "192.168.0.10") and click Enter.
  3. Enter the user name (default: admin) and password (default: admin) in the pop-up dialogue box and click OK
  4. Click on Network. Configure the phone to use DHCP (obtain an IP address automatically) or Static IP address.

Door Opening feature (optional)

During conversation with the Door Station a relay can be operated by pressing digit 6 on the Snom phone. The Snom phone uses DTMF by RFC2833 by default, which is supported by AlphaCom, so no settings are required in the phone.

In AlphaCom the relay must be mapped to a logical RCO, and an "Door Opening" event created to trigger this RCO.

To map a logical RCO to the relay of the IP Station, select Exchange & System -> RCO. Pick a free RCO, select Change and set the RCO Type = Station, enter the physical number of the IP Station, and set pin number = 1. In the example below the relay of IP Video Door station 48 (directory number 148) is mapped to RCO 11.

Logical RCO 11 is mapped to the relay of station 48



Create a "Door Opening" event with the IP Video Door Station as the event owner. Select Exchange & System -> Events, and Insert a new event with the following properties:

During conversation with the door station (148), pressing digit 6 will trigger the relay (RCO 11)

Manual video image

The video image can be started and ended manually by pressing a function key. With this feature the video image can be displayed without setting up a conversation.

In the web interface of the phone, select Function Keys in the menu, and enter the following parameters:


Pressing function key 1 will start the video image from camera 10.5.101.97



  • Start video image by pressing the programmed key.
  • End video image by pressing the "X-key".

Authentication

If the access of the CP-CAM camera is to be password protected, the following adjustments are necessary to the URL:

  • http://<User name>:<Password>@<IP adress of the camera>/snoma.cgi. If for example username is "admin" and the password is "1234", enter http://admin:1234@10.5.101.97/snoma.cgi

Axis camera - Uploading .XML file

When the Snom Phone is used to show an image from an Axis camera, an .xml file must be uploaded to the camera. This is applicable for IP Video Door Station model 1401110200 as well as when using standalone Axis camera.

  • Create a new textfile on your windows desktop and rename it to snomaxis.xml.
  • Open the file with a text editor e.g. Notepad
  • Copy the following lines to the snomaxis.xml text file: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
 <SnomIPPhoneImageFile state="relevant" track="no" dtmf="on" >
 <LocationX>00</LocationX>
 <LocationY>00</LocationY>
 <url>http://<ip-address>/axis-cgi/jpg/image.cgi?resolution=320x240</url>
 <fetch mil="100">http://<ip-address>/local/viewer/snomaxis.xml</fetch>
 </SnomIPPhoneImageFile>
  • Replace the two <ip-address> tags with the IP address of your camera.
  • Save the file.
  • Etablish a FTP connection to the IP camera, using e.g. the PC tool WinSCP. Use the same username and password as the login on the webinterface.
  • Navigate to the following folder: /mnt/flash/etc/httpd/html/viewer
  • Copy the snomaxis.xml into the folder.
  • Close the FTP connection.

Firmware update of Snom phone

In order to support video, the Snom phone must have the correct firmware. The firmware is uploaded using a TFTP server.

Upgrade procedure:

  • Download firmware for the relevant Snom model from the AlphaWiki download site
  • Unzip the file. Remember in which folder you stored the file
  • Start a TFTP server, and browse to the folder which contains the file. A TFTP server can be downloaded here: TFTP server
  • In the Snom webinterface, select Software Update and enter address tftp://[TFTPServer]/[file name], where [TFTPServer] = IP address of PC running the TFTP server and [file name] is the name of the downloaded .bin file.
    • Example: tftp://10.5.101.129/snom821-8.7.4.8-SIP-r.bin.
  • Select Load, and watch the progress on the display of the Snom phone
Starting the software upgrade process



Note: It is not recommended to use newer beta versions like 8.7.5.10, 8.7.5.12 or 8.7.5.13 as they have known issues with the video handling.
